Arduino Nano Teknik Özellikleri Nelerdir?

Arduino Nano, Arduino’nun en küçük boyutlara sahip klasik breadboard dostu tasarımlı kartıdır. Arduino Nano, bir devre tahtasına kolay bağlantı sağlayan pin başlıklarıyla birlikte gelir ve bir Mini-B USB konektörü içerir.

Teknik Özellikleri

MikrodenetleyiciAtmega328
Usb BağlantısıMini B Usb
Dahili Led Pini13
Dijital Giriş-Çıkış Pin Sayısı14
Analog Giriş Pin Sayısı8
Pwm Pin Sayısı6
UART BağlantısıVar
I2C Bağlantısı Var
SPI Bağlantısı Var
Giriş-Çıkış Voltajı5V
Giriş Voltajı7-12V
Giriş-Çıkış Pini Başına Düşen Akım20mA
İşlemci HızıATmega328 16 MHz
Atmega328P Hafızası2KB SRAM, 32KB flash 1KB EEPROM
Ağırlık5gr
Genişlik18mm
Uzunluk45mm

Arduino Pin Diyagramı

Arduino Nano Pin Diyagramı

Güç: Harici güç kaynağı olarak 6-20V arası kullanılabilir. Ancak bu değerler limit değerleridir. Kart için önerilen harici besleme 7-12V arasıdır. Çünkü kart üzerinde bulunan regülatör 7V altındaki değerlerde stabil çalışmayabilir. 12V üstündeki değerlerde de aşırı ısınabilir. Nano kartının üzerindeki mikrodenetleyicinin çalışma gerilimi 5V’dur. Vin pini veya güç soketi üzerinden verilen 7-12V arası gerilim kart üzerinde bulunan voltaj regülatörü ile 5V’a düşürülerek karta dağılır.

  • VIN: Harici güç kaynağı kullanılırken 7-12V arası gerilim giriş pini. 
  • 5V: Bu pin regülatörden çıkan 5V çıkışı verir. Eğer kart sadece usb (5V) üzerinden çalışıyor ise usb üzerinden gelen 5V doğrudan bu pin üzerinden çıkış olarak verilir. Aynı zamanda bu pin üzerinden 5V girişi yapılabilir.  Eğer karta güç Vin (7-12V) üzerinden veriliyorsa regülatörden çıkan 5V doğrudan bu pin üzerinden çıkış olarak verilir.
  • 3V3: Kart üzerinde bulunan 3.3V regülatörü çıkış pinidir. Maks. 50mA çıkış verebilir.
  • GND: Toprak pinleridir.

Giriş ve Çıkış: Nano üzerindeki 14 adet dijital pinin hepsi giriş veya çıkış olarak kullanılabilir. 8 tane analog giriş pini de bulunmaktadır. Bu analog giriş pinleri de aynı şekilde dijital giriş ve çıkış olarak kullanılabilir. Yani kart üzerinde toplam 20 tane dijital giriş çıkış pini vardır. Bu pinlerin tamamının lojik seviyesi 5V’dur. Her pin maks. 40mA giriş ve çıkış akımı ile çalışır. Ek olarak, bazı pinlerin farklı özellikleri bulunmaktadır. Özel pinler aşağıda belirtildiği gibidir.

  • Seri Haberleşme, 0 (RX) ve 1 (TX): TTL Seri veri alıp (RX), vermek (TX) için kullanılır. Bu pinler doğrudan kart üzerinde bulunan FT232 usb-seri dönüştürücüsüne bağlıdır. Yani bilgisayardan karta kod yüklerken veya bilgisayar-nano arasında karşılıklı haberleşme yapılırken de bu pinler kullanılır. O yüzden karta kod yüklerken veya haberleşme yapılırken hata olmaması için mecbur kalınmadıkça bu pinlerin kullanılmamasında fayda vardır.
  • Harici Kesme, 2 (interrupt 0) ve 3 (interrupt 1): Bu pinler yükselen kenar, düşen kenar veya değişiklik kesmesi pinleri olarak kullanılabilir.
  • PWM, 3,5,6,9,10 ve 11: 8-bit çözünürlükte PWM çıkış pinleri olarak kullanılabilir.
  • SPI, 10 (SS), 11 (MOSI), 12 (MISO), 13 (SCK): Bu pinler SPI haberleşmesi için kullanılır.
  • LED, 13: Nano üzerinden 13. pine bağlı olan dahili bir led bulunmaktadır. Pin HIGH yapıldığında led yanacak, LOW yapıldığında led sönecektir. .
  • Analog, A0-A7: Nano 8 tane 10-bit çözünürlüğünde analog giriş pinine sahiptir. Bu pinler dijital giriş ve çıkış içinde kullanılabilir. Pinlerin ölçüm aralığı 0-5V’dur. AREF pini ve analogReference() foksiyonu kullanılarak alt limit yükseltilip, üst limit düşürülebilir.
  • I2C, A4 veya SDA pini ve A5 veya SCL pini: Bu pinler I2C haberleşmesi için kullanılır. 
  • AREF: Analog giriş için referans pini.
  • Reset: Mikrodenetleyici resetlenmek istendiğinde bu pin LOW yapılır. Reset işlemi kart üzerinde bulunan Reset Butonu ile de yapılabilir.

Arduino Nano Kart Şematiği

Arduino Nano Eagle PCB Çizim Dosyası